Distance Learning Program
Purpose
The Institute for Puritans and Baptist Studies program is offered to those who have desire to in-depth study about the heritage of Puritans' and Calvinistic Baptist's theological and practice to apply in this ministry today. This program offer Bachelor of Theology (B.Th), Master of Ministry (M.Min.), Master of Divinity (M.Div), Master of Theology (M.Th), and Master of Art in Puritan Studies (M.A. ). All of degrees can be completed by distance learning or self study in your own country and place with use Internet. It is designed to equip candidates for the teaching and pastoral ministry, or prepare them for postgraduate studies.
Admission Requirements
The M.Min., M.Div., M.Th., and MA programs is offered to those already have an Bachelor degree from an approved institution both theological and non-theological area when they enter Institute for Puritans Studies.
Program Requirements
B.Th. students must complete in 4 (four) years courses, M.Min. students must complete in 1 (one) year courses beyond Bachelor, M.Div. students must complete in 2 (two) years courses beyond Bachelor or 1 (one) years courses beyond M.Min. M.Th. students must complete in 3 (three) years courses beyond Bachelor or 2 (two) years course beyond M.Min. or 1 (one) year courses beyond M.Div. MA students must complete 1 (one) year beyond Bachelor of Theology). A thesis on an approved biblical-theological theme in Puritans and Baptist perspective is to be presented in the final year.
Graduation Requirements
Candidates must complete all courses requirement with a minimum
GPA of 3.0. A grade of at least ‘B’ is required for all courses. Evidence to the
faculty of approved Christian character must also be shown. The successful
candidate must be present at the graduation service for the conferral of the
degree.
